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: Yes
  • Step free access coverage: No
  • Step free access note: This station does not have step-free access, however step-free interchange is available between District line and London Overground trains.
  • Accessible taxis: Contact taxi operator directly. Taxi Rank to the west of the Chiswick High Road entrance outside shops.
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Accessible ticket machines note: Accessible ticket machines sell tickets suitable for use on London Underground services, including daily and weekly Travelcards.
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: No
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No

Gunnersbury station offers accessibility services, with staff help available for passengers with reduced mobility.
Gunnersbury station is located near attractions such as Gunnersbury Park and Museum, Kew Gardens, and the Royal Botanic Gardens.
There is no car rental service available at Gunnersbury.
Gunnersbury station is approximately 10.496 kilometers from the city center.
From Gunnersbury station, you can reach the city center by taking the District Line of the Metro, or you can use the rail replacement bus services that stop on Chiswick High Road outside the station.
For optimal travel experience at Gunnersbury station, it is advisable to arrive at least 10-15 minutes before your scheduled departure to allow sufficient time for ticket checks and boarding.
Gunnersbury station is located at Chiswick High Road, Chiswick, Greater London, W4 4AN.
There is no car park available at Gunnersbury station.
Currently, there is no direct train service from Gunnersbury to an airport; travelers typically transfer at another station for connections to nearby airports.
The Gunnersbury station is served by the District Line for metro services, and replacement buses for rail services stop in Chiswick High Road outside the station.
